1/3 c. butter, melted
1/2 c. sugar
1 egg
1 1/2 c. all purpose flour
1 1/2 tsp. baking powder
1/2 tsp. salt
1/4 tsp. nutmeg
1/2 c. milk
1 tsp. Cinnamon
1. Preheat oven to 350F.
2. In a medium-large bowl, sift together all dry ingredients.
3. Add wet ingredients and stir just until combined, but still a bit lumpy. Do not overmix; overmixing will ruin the texture of the finished muffins.
4. Scoop batter into muffin tins that have sprayed with cooking spray.
5. Using a large ice cream scoop, you can get 8 medium-large muffins out of this batter; I think you could get 10-12 muffins by distributing the batter a little less generously.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until they just start to turn a bit golden at the edges.
6. For the topping, mix sugar(1/2 c.) and cinnamon in a small bowl. Place melted butter (1/2 c.) in another small bowl. Dip the warm muffins in melted butter (you can dip just the top, but it's even tastier to dip the whole muffin), then dip/roll the muffin in cinnamon sugar.
